Tracey paid $145 for an item that was originally priced at $460. What percent of the original price did Tracey pay?

It is given in the question that

Tracey paid $145 for an item that was originally priced at $460.

And we have to find what percent of the original price did Tracey pay.

So we have to find the percentage of 145 out of 460, and for that, we have to divide 145 by 460 and multiply the result by 100. THat is

[tex]\frac{145}{460}*100=31.52 percentage[/tex]

And that's the required answer .
